微信小程序focus(微信小程序店铺怎么开)

小编

怎么在微信小程序中使用textarea多行输入框?

1、被键盘遮挡可以通过设置cursor-spacing来解决光标位置出现在倒数第二个字的后面这种是在获取焦点后,动态修改了textarea的高度,以便于让用户在更大的显示区输入。

2、selection-start与selection-end属性:管理光标位置,实现文本选择功能。adjust-position属性:键盘弹起时,自动调整页面位置以保持输入框可见。bindfocus事件:输入框聚焦时触发,用于执行聚焦相关的逻辑操作。bindblur事件:输入框失去焦点时触发,用于处理焦点转移后的操作。

3、第一步,打开微信小程序开发工具,在指定的wxml文件中插入一个textarea组件,设置最大长度、失去焦点事件等。第二步,在界面对应的JavaScript文件,添加失去焦点事件,并获取文本域文字内容。第三步,接着保存代码并在模拟器中预览界面显示效果,可以看到一个文本域。

4、详细内容:在HTML表单中使用textarea元素时,可通过maxlength属性限制输入的字符数量。使用maxlength属性时应注意以下几点: 确定合理的最大字符数量,以避免输入过多导致的性能问题或数据安全风险。 注意maxlength属性不会影响实际的输入效果,仅在浏览器中展示限制信息。

微信小程序实现活动报名登记功能(实例代码)

1、获取地理位置信息时,用户点击输入框后,小程序会调用地图组件,根据用户定位或地图选点获取经纬度等信息。此功能通过为input组件绑定focus事件实现。上传微信收款二维码功能允许用户输入费用,依据费用大小动态显示上传图片组件。用户上传图片后,页面会显示上传的图片内容。此功能通过监听费用input组件的input事件实现。

微信小程序focus(微信小程序店铺怎么开)

2、选用专业预约类小程序:在微信中搜索“预约小程序”,选择排名靠前的产品,如【快预约】,支持****。 使用【选课】模板快速配置:快预约提供多种比赛模板,结合行业需求,复用模板快速创建。 在参照模板基础上,按需进行修改和调整,如比赛项目、报名须知和所需提交的信息等。

3、选择专业预约类小程序: 在微信中搜索“预约小程序”,选择排名靠前且功能强大的产品,例如【快预约】,这些小程序通常支持****,能够满足基本的报名需求。 利用模板快速配置: 选用预约小程序中的【选课】或其他适合的模板,这些模板已经针对比赛活动进行了预设,可以快速复用。

4、活动报名小程序和微信报名系统的制作方法如下:核心功能设计 活动信息发布:活动页面需详细展示活动信息,包括时间、地点、内容等,方便用户查看。自定义报名表单:允许主办方根据活动需求设置报名表单,收集必要信息。报名管理:后台管理系统应支持主办方审核和管理报名信息,确保信息的准确性和完整性。

5、要在微信设置报名系统,可以通过以下方式实现:利用小程序:选择或开发小程序:你可以选择在微信小程序平台上搜索已有的报名系统小程序,这些小程序通常提供了便捷的报名功能,适用于各种活动或课程。如果你有特殊需求,也可以考虑开发一个定制的小程序。

全世界最著名的旅游景点有哪些?

1、金字塔:作为世界七大奇迹中唯一尚存的古迹,金字塔以其宏伟壮观的建筑和深厚的历史文化底蕴吸引着全球游客。罗马斗兽场:作为古罗马文明的象征,罗马斗兽场见证了古罗马帝国的辉煌历史,是历史爱好者的必游之地。自然风光类:大堡礁:作为世界上最大的珊瑚礁系统,大堡礁以其绚丽多彩的海底世界和丰富的海洋生物资源而闻名于世。

微信小程序focus(微信小程序店铺怎么开)

2、全世界最美最著名的旅游景点包括但不限于以下几个:塞尔维亚罗赖马山:罗赖马山因其独特的地理景观而闻名,是众多河流的发源地。常年流水侵蚀形成的独特地貌,使其成为了电影《飞屋环游记》中“天堂瀑布”的原型。冰岛塞里雅兰瀑布:塞里雅兰瀑布如同一条垂下的绸缎,景色壮观。

3、全世界最著名的旅游景点主要包括以下几个:好望角:位置:非洲南端。特点:一条细长的岩石岬角,是非洲的标志性景点,景色壮丽,气象万千,是非洲旅游爱好者必到之地。美国大峡谷:位置:美国。特点:由科罗拉多河穿流其中,是地球上最为壮丽的景色之一,也是联合国教科文组织保护的天然遗产之一。

4、法国卢浮宫:作为世界四大博物馆之一,卢浮宫收藏了大量珍贵的艺术品,是艺术爱好者的必游之地。埃菲尔铁塔:作为巴黎的标志性建筑,埃菲尔铁塔不仅是法国的象征,也是全球最著名的旅游景点之一。

微信小程序bindchange是什么事件

1、bindChange为输入框发生改变事件。微信提供的bindchange在支持方面还有小问题,目前是失去焦点才能触发到此事件的发生。

2、通过给表单组件绑定bindchange事件,在switch、radio-group、checkbox-group、slider、input控件上添加bindchange方法,当这些控件的checked或input发生改变时,会触发change事件,通过携带事件对象,可以直接获取到表单组件的值。

3、事件是渲染层到逻辑层的通讯方式。通过事件可以将用户在渲染层产生的行为,反馈到逻辑层进行业务的处理。

4、bindblur事件:输入框失去焦点时触发,用于处理焦点转移后的操作。bindlinechange事件:输入框行数变化时触发,用于调整布局或处理文字换行。bindinput事件:输入内容变化时触发,实时处理用户输入事件。bindconfirm事件:完成按钮被点击时触发,用于提交或确认输入内容。

5、在myPicker组件中,我们使用了van-search组件来实现搜索功能,通过bind:change事件监听用户输入的变化,并将输入的关键词传递给父组件。同时,我们通过picker-view和picker-view-column组件来实现滚动选择功能。当用户选择某个学校后,通过触发自定义事件将选择结果传递给父组件。

css伪类选择器after?

微信小程序CSS选择器:after和:before的简单使用前两天看文档看到选择器那块儿的时候,前面4个基本都能理解:.class,#id,element,element,element,但后面两个:after和:before(文档中说,分别表示在view组件的后面和前面插入内容),表示有点没有理解。于是上网仔细查了下。

这个选择器用于在选定元素之前插入内容。通过content属性指定要插入的文本或样式。CSS :after 选择器 与:before类似,这个选择器在选定元素之后插入内容,同样使用content属性设置插入的内容。以下是几种常见使用场景: 伪类光圈 使用伪元素创建动态光圈效果,增强元素视觉吸引力。

在CSS中,:before和:after是用于在元素内容前或后插入内容的伪类。它们能辅助开发者在不增加实际HTML标签的情况下,增强元素的视觉效果。尽管如此,它们在实际项目中的应用相对较少,但其巧妙之处不容忽视。

微信小程序focus(微信小程序店铺怎么开)

在CSS世界中,:after与:before常常被遗忘,但实际上它们在页面布局中扮演着关键角色。这两个伪类元素主要功能是添加额外内容,包括文本与元素,到元素前后。概念理解::before表示前增内容,:after表示后增内容。它们通常用于解决常见的CSS布局问题。

揭秘伪类选择器 **伪类选择器简介 伪类选择器,是为特定状态下的元素量身打造的CSS选择器,如鼠标悬停、点击、被访问等状态。 **语法要点 注意,伪类名称对大小写不敏感。 **常用伪类实例 - **`:hover`**:改变元素在鼠标悬停时的样式。

伪类选择器:通过元素的特定状态选择元素。例如,:hover 用于选择鼠标悬停时的元素,:active 用于选择被激活的元素。伪元素选择器:通过元素的特定部分选择元素。例如,:before 用于在元素内容的前面插入内容,:after 用于在元素内容的后面插入内容。

微信小程序--表单组件textarea

在微信小程序中,使用textarea组件创建多行输入框,实现复杂文本输入功能。其关键属性与功能如下:value属性:设置输入框内的文本内容,实现数据绑定。placeholder属性:在输入框为空时显示提示信息,提升用户体验。placeholder-style属性:自定义占位符样式,通过CSS样式调整其外观。

第一步,打开微信小程序开发工具,在指定的wxml文件中插入一个textarea组件,设置最大长度、失去焦点事件等。第二步,在界面对应的JavaScript文件,添加失去焦点事件,并获取文本域文字内容。第三步,接着保存代码并在模拟器中预览界面显示效果,可以看到一个文本域。

事情起因:在开发微信小程序前端时,遇到了一个使用多行输入框(textarea)属性的问题,自己一直未能解决,最后在同事的帮助下找到答案。事情经过:在写小程序前端时,使用了textarea属性,却遇到困扰多时的难题,一直未能找到解决方法,最后求助同事才得以解决。

在开发小程序时遇到的问题,尤其是关于textarea在fixed元素下方的点击问题,通过观察与分析,发现其背后的原因涉及到渲染引擎以及组件层级的差异。

在写一个小程序界面的时候,发现这个页面的按钮点击失效,打印log打印不出来,而其他页面的点击事件仍旧可以触发。找了半天发现按钮被textarea组件遮挡了,导致点击不到。解决办法:给textarea添加样式,修改它的高度。

通过icon属性设置按钮图标,支持 Icon 组件里的所有图标,也可以传入图标 URL。

内容声明:本文中引用的各种信息及资料(包括但不限于文字、数据、图表及超链接等)均来源于该信息及资料的相关主体(包括但不限于公司、媒体、协会等机构》的官方网站或公开发表的信息,内容仅供参考使用!本站为非盈利性质站点,本着免费分享原则,发布内容不收取任何费用也不接任何广告! 【若侵害到您的利益,请联系我们删除处理。投诉邮箱:121998431@qq.com